    How to prevent desktop icons from changing positions

    Hi Stephen,

    There are various reasons why you're experiencing the issue. Let us isolate your concern by enabling the
    Auto arrange icons option, and then disabling it to see if the issue will persist. To do this follow these steps:

    • Go to the Desktop screen, and then right click anywhere.
    • Hover your mouse on View.
    • Select Auto arrange icons.
    • Restart the computer.
    • After restarting the computer, check if your Desktop icons are still in the right position after clicking the
      Auto arrange icons option.
    • If your Desktop icons are in the right position, repeat steps 1-3 to disable the
      Auto arrange icons option.
    • Customize the position of your Desktop icons.
    • Restart the computer.
    • After restarting the computer, check if the issue will occur.
